IN NO EVENT SHALL + * THE AUTHORS OR COPYRIGHT HOLDERS BE LIABLE FOR ANY CLAIM, DAMAGES OR OTHER + * LIABILITY, WHETHER IN AN ACTION OF CONTRACT, TORT OR OTHERWISE, ARISING FROM, + * OUT OF OR IN CONNECTION WITH THE SOFTWARE OR THE USE OR OTHER DEALINGS IN + * THE SOFTWARE. + */ + +#include "qemu-common.h" +#include "qemu-coroutine.h" +#include "qemu-coroutine-int.h" +#include "qemu-queue.h" +#include "trace.h" + +static QTAILQ_HEAD(, Coroutine) unlock_bh_queue = + QTAILQ_HEAD_INITIALIZER(unlock_bh_queue); + +struct unlock_bh { + QEMUBH *bh; +}; + +static void qemu_co_queue_next_bh(void *opaque) +{ + struct unlock_bh *unlock_bh = opaque; + Coroutine *next; + + trace_qemu_co_queue_next_bh(); + while ((next = QTAILQ_FIRST(&unlock_bh_queue))) { + QTAILQ_REMOVE(&unlock_bh_queue, next, co_queue_next); + qemu_coroutine_enter(next, NULL); + } + + qemu_bh_delete(unlock_bh->bh); + qemu_free(unlock_bh); +} + +void qemu_co_queue_init(CoQueue *queue) +{ + QTAILQ_INIT(&queue->entries); +} + +void coroutine_fn qemu_co_queue_wait(CoQueue *queue) +{ + Coroutine *self = qemu_coroutine_self(); + QTAILQ_INSERT_TAIL(&queue->entries, self, co_queue_next); + qemu_coroutine_yield(); + assert(qemu_in_coroutine()); +} + +bool qemu_co_queue_next(CoQueue *queue) +{ + struct unlock_bh *unlock_bh; + Coroutine *next; + + next = QTAILQ_FIRST(&queue->entries); + if (next) { + QTAILQ_REMOVE(&queue->entries, next, co_queue_next); + QTAILQ_INSERT_TAIL(&unlock_bh_queue, next, co_queue_next); + trace_qemu_co_queue_next(next); + + unlock_bh = qemu_malloc(sizeof(*unlock_bh)); + unlock_bh->bh = qemu_bh_new(qemu_co_queue_next_bh, unlock_bh); + qemu_bh_schedule(unlock_bh->bh); + } + + return (next != NULL); +} + +bool qemu_co_queue_empty(CoQueue *queue) +{ + return (QTAILQ_FIRST(&queue->entries) == NULL); +} + +void qemu_co_mutex_init(CoMutex *mutex) +{ + memset(mutex, 0, sizeof(*mutex)); + qemu_co_queue_init(&mutex->queue); +} + +void coroutine_fn qemu_co_mutex_lock(CoMutex *mutex) +{ + Coroutine *self = qemu_coroutine_self(); + + trace_qemu_co_mutex_lock_entry(mutex, self); + + while (mutex->locked) { + qemu_co_queue_wait(&mutex->queue); + } + + mutex->locked = true; + + trace_qemu_co_mutex_lock_return(mutex, self); +} + +void coroutine_fn qemu_co_mutex_unlock(CoMutex *mutex) +{ + Coroutine *self = qemu_coroutine_self(); + + trace_qemu_co_mutex_unlock_entry(mutex, self); + + assert(mutex->locked == true); + assert(qemu_in_coroutine()); + + mutex->locked = false; + qemu_co_queue_next(&mutex->queue); + + trace_qemu_co_mutex_unlock_return(mutex, self); +} diff --git a/qemu-coroutine.h b/qemu-coroutine.h index 08255c7..2f2fd95 100644 --- a/qemu-coroutine.h +++ b/qemu-coroutine.h @@ -5,6 +5,7 @@ * * Authors: * Stefan Hajnoczi + * Kevin Wolf * * This work is licensed under the terms of the GNU LGPL, version 2 or later. * See the COPYING.LIB file in the top-level directory. @@ -15,6 +16,7 @@ #define QEMU_COROUTINE_H #include +#include "qemu-queue.h" /** * Coroutines are a mechanism for stack switching and can be used for @@ -92,4 +94,66 @@ Coroutine *coroutine_fn qemu_coroutine_self(void); */ bool qemu_in_coroutine(void); + + +/** + * CoQueues are a mechanism to queue coroutines in order to continue executing + * them later. They provide the fundamental primitives on which coroutine locks + * are built. + */ +typedef struct CoQueue { + QTAILQ_HEAD(, Coroutine) entries; +} CoQueue; + +/** + * Initialise a CoQueue. This must be called before any other operation is used + * on the CoQueue. + */ +void qemu_co_queue_init(CoQueue *queue); + +/** + * Adds the current coroutine to the CoQueue and transfers control to the + * caller of the coroutine. + */ +void coroutine_fn qemu_co_queue_wait(CoQueue *queue); + +/** + * Restarts the next coroutine in the CoQueue and removes it from the queue. + * + * Returns true if a coroutine was restarted, false if the queue is empty. + */ +bool qemu_co_queue_next(CoQueue *queue); + +/** + * Checks if the CoQueue is empty. + */ +bool qemu_co_queue_empty(CoQueue *queue); + + +/** + * Provides a mutex that can be used to synchronise coroutines + */ +typedef struct CoMutex { + bool locked; + CoQueue queue; +} CoMutex; + +/** + * Initialises a CoMutex. This must be called before any other operation is used + * on the CoMutex. + */ +void qemu_co_mutex_init(CoMutex *mutex); + +/** + * Locks the mutex. If the lock cannot be taken immediately, control is + * transferred to the caller of the current coroutine. + */ +void coroutine_fn qemu_co_mutex_lock(CoMutex *mutex); + +/** + * Unlocks the mutex and schedules the next coroutine that was waiting for this + * lock to be run. + */ +void coroutine_fn qemu_co_mutex_unlock(CoMutex *mutex); + #endif /* QEMU_COROUTINE_H */ diff --git a/trace-events b/trace-events index bc9be30..19d31e3 100644 --- a/trace-events +++ b/trace-events @@ -433,3 +433,11 @@ disable xen_platform_log(char *s) "xen platform: %s" disable qemu_coroutine_enter(void *from, void *to, void *opaque) "from %p to %p opaque %p" disable qemu_coroutine_yield(void *from, void *to) "from %p to %p" disable qemu_coroutine_terminate(void *co) "self %p" + +# qemu-coroutine-lock.c +disable qemu_co_queue_next_bh(void) "" +disable qemu_co_queue_next(void *next) "next %p" +disable qemu_co_mutex_lock_entry(void *mutex, void *self) "mutex %p self %p" +disable qemu_co_mutex_lock_return(void *mutex, void *self) "mutex %p self %p" +disable qemu_co_mutex_unlock_entry(void *mutex, void *self) "mutex %p self %p" +disable qemu_co_mutex_unlock_return(void *mutex, void *self) "mutex %p self %p"
